The Rotary Friction Welding marketplace revolves around a high-velocity welding procedure used to sign up for materials, especially metals, with special compositions or sizes. It entails rotating one element against every other at high speeds while making use of stress, generating warmth through friction. This localized warmth softens the material, allowing for a bond to shape when the rotation ceases and pressure is maintained. This method offers numerous blessings, together with excessive energy joints, minimal material waste, and the capability to weld distinctive metals. It reveals programs in various industries, which include car, aerospace, and production for producing additives like engine components, shafts, and valves. Despite their undeniable blessings, the adoption of rotary friction welding machines can be hindered with the aid of the considerable preliminary funding required. The high price related to acquiring and imposing this technology may dissuade some manufacturers from embracing it completely. While the lengthy-term advantages in terms of productivity, nice, and operational performance are extensive, the in-advance economic outlay can pose a barrier, particularly for small and medium-sized organizations with limited capital assets. Additionally, the complexity of setting up and preservation similarly compounds the preliminary investment-demanding situations. However, for agencies willing to make the in advance investment, the capacity returns in phrases of advanced production talents and competitiveness often justify the preliminary price, ultimately leading to lengthy-term fulfillment and growth.

According to Cognitive Market Research, the global Rotary Friction Welding market size was estimated at USD 236.6 Million, out of which North America held the major market of more than 40% of the global revenue with a market size of USD 94.64 million in 2024 and will grow at a compound annual growth rate (CAGR) of 2.2% from 2024 to 2031.
According to Cognitive Market Research, the global Rotary Friction Welding market size was estimated at USD 236.6 Million out of which Europe held the market of more than 30% of the global revenue with a market size of USD 70.98 million in 2024 and will grow at a compound annual growth rate (CAGR) of 2.5% from 2024 to 2031.
According to Cognitive Market Research, the global Rotary Friction Welding market size was estimated at USD 236.6 Million, out of which Asia Pacific held the market of around 23% of the global revenue with a market size of USD 54.42 million in 2024 and will grow at a compound annual growth rate (CAGR) of 6.00% from 2024 to 2031.
According to Cognitive Market Research, the global Rotary Friction Welding market size was estimated at USD 236.6 Million out of which Latin America market of more than 5% of the global revenue with a market size of USD 11.83 million in 2024 and will grow at a compound annual growth rate (CAGR) of 3.4% from 2024 to 2031.
According to Cognitive Market Research, the global Rotary Friction Welding market size was estimated at USD 236.6 Million, out of which the Middle East and Africa held the major market of around 2% of the global revenue with a market size of USD 4.73 million in 2024 and will grow at a compound annual growth rate (CAGR) of 3.7% from 2024 to 2031.
